Accelerate your growth in operations and supply chain with Armstrong's Graduate Development Program. Participate in immersive rotations that provide critical insights into manufacturing and logistics.
As a recent graduate, this 18-month program allows you to develop skills through operational tasks and strategic planning. You will learn to apply analytical and process improvement techniques within a supportive team setting. Experience firsthand the integration of cutting-edge practices that power Armstrong's global supply chain.
Key Responsibilities:
• Rotate through key operations and supply chain functions
• Engage in process mapping and improvement initiatives
• Contribute to cross-functional teams on product delivery
• Utilize MS Excel and ERP systems for data analysis
• Document and share findings through transparent communications
Requirements:
• Recent bachelor’s degree in relevant engineering or business fields
• Familiarity with supply chain principles from prior experiences
• Strong problem-solving and analytical capabilities
• Team-oriented with effective communication skills
• Commitment to operational excellence and innovation
